Abstract
The present work discusses some improvements that have been introduced in a dynamic model, which was developed for simulating the two-phase flow transient phenomena associated with underbalanced drilling operations. The model enhancements are basically obtained by implementing mechanistic closure relationships and more accurate numerical schemes. This process of improvement is validated through comparison to full-scale experimental data in transient scenarios, showing that the gains in terms of increasing the model accuracy are significant.
